本文目录导读:
在当今信息化时代,数据已经成为企业和社会发展的核心资源,随着互联网、物联网、大数据等技术的飞速发展,数据量呈爆炸式增长,如何实现海量数据的高效检索成为了一个亟待解决的问题,本文将为您揭秘亿级存储秒级查询的奥秘,带您了解如何实现海量数据的高效检索。
亿级存储秒级查询的背景
随着互联网、物联网、大数据等技术的广泛应用,企业和社会对数据的需求日益增长,数据量呈几何级数增长,用户对数据检索的响应速度要求越来越高,传统的数据库系统在处理海量数据时,往往存在查询速度慢、性能瓶颈等问题,无法满足亿级存储秒级查询的需求。
图片来源于网络,如有侵权联系删除
亿级存储秒级查询的技术原理
1、分布式存储
分布式存储技术可以将海量数据分散存储在多个节点上,实现数据的高可用性和高性能,在分布式存储系统中,数据可以按照一定的规则进行分区,每个分区存储一部分数据,从而提高查询效率。
2、数据索引
数据索引是提高查询速度的关键技术,通过对数据进行索引,可以快速定位到所需数据,减少查询过程中需要访问的数据量,常见的索引技术有B树索引、哈希索引、全文索引等。
3、内存优化
内存优化技术可以将热点数据缓存到内存中,减少磁盘I/O操作,从而提高查询速度,常见的内存优化技术有LRU(最近最少使用)算法、缓存淘汰策略等。
4、并行查询
图片来源于网络,如有侵权联系删除
并行查询技术可以将查询任务分配到多个节点上,实现查询任务的并行处理,从而提高查询效率,常见的并行查询技术有MapReduce、Spark等。
5、数据压缩
数据压缩技术可以将存储空间进行压缩,减少存储空间占用,提高存储效率,常见的压缩算法有Huffman编码、LZ77、LZ78等。
亿级存储秒级查询的应用场景
1、搜索引擎
搜索引擎需要处理海量网页数据,实现快速、准确的搜索结果,亿级存储秒级查询技术可以帮助搜索引擎提高检索速度,提高用户体验。
2、大数据分析
大数据分析需要对海量数据进行实时处理和分析,亿级存储秒级查询技术可以帮助大数据分析系统快速获取所需数据,提高分析效率。
图片来源于网络,如有侵权联系删除
3、电子商务
电子商务平台需要对海量商品信息进行快速检索,实现精准推荐,亿级存储秒级查询技术可以帮助电商平台提高检索速度,提高用户满意度。
4、物联网
物联网设备需要实时收集和处理海量数据,亿级存储秒级查询技术可以帮助物联网系统快速获取所需数据,提高设备运行效率。
亿级存储秒级查询技术是应对海量数据高效检索的重要手段,通过分布式存储、数据索引、内存优化、并行查询、数据压缩等技术,可以实现海量数据的高效检索,随着技术的不断发展,亿级存储秒级查询技术将在更多领域得到应用,为企业和社会创造更大的价值。
标签: #亿级存储秒级查询数据库
评论列表